Ye & Ty Dolla $ign’s ‘Carnival’ Remains Atop TikTok Billboard Top 50 For Second Week

Kanye West and Ty Dolla $ign‘s “Carnival,” featuring Rich the Kid and Playboi Carti, remains atop the TikTok Billboard Top 50 chart for the second week.

“Carnival” remains the chart’s top song, becoming the first to reign for more than one week since Flo Milli‘s “Never Lose Me” ruled for four frames between January 20 and February 10.

The song also rose to No. 1 on the Billboard Hot 100 dated March 16.

“Carnival” earned 33.7 million streams, up 4%, and 3.9 million radio airplay audience impressions, up 85%, and sold 3,000 downloads, up 15%, in the March 1-7 tracking week, according to Luminate.

The track was released on February 10 on Ye and Ty Dolla $ign’s collaborative album Vultures 1.
